Starter of kohlrabi with wild rice
Kohlrabi is one of the most useful types of cabbage. Wild rice is also known as one of the most useful. Although, this does not rice, and marsh grass. In my fictional dish you'll find an interesting combination of flavors and textures.

Ingredients

  • Kohlrabi

    300 g

  • Wild rice

    5 Tbsp

  • Dried apricots

    10 piece

  • Walnuts

    4 Tbsp

  • Cilantro

    3 Tbsp

  • Rum

    20 g

  • Walnut oil

    1 Tbsp

  • Lemon juice

    3 Tbsp

  • Lemon peel

    1 Tbsp

  • Salt

  • Black pepper

Cooking

step-0
Dried apricots coarsely chop and pour light rum. Leave for an hour, periodically shake or just stir.
step-1
Wild rice (not to be confused with black rice) from Mistral pour water in the ratio 1:3, bring to a boil and cook under lid on low heat for about 50 minutes. The rice is ready when most of the seeds will reveal.
step-2
Dried apricots with liquid to break the immersion blender. Add the juice and zest of a lemon, walnut oil, salt and black pepper.
step-3
Stir in the ground in the hot rice and keep it for 15 minutes. During this time, the alcohol flavour will evaporate and the rice will get the necessary flavor and aroma.
step-4
Kohlrabi peel and cut into slices with a thickness of 3-5 mm.
step-5
Boil in salted water 5 minutes. Then quickly cool in ice water and drain on paper towel. Interestingly, kohlrabi does not lose its beneficial properties during heat treatment.
step-6
To the cooled rice add the walnuts and coriander. Try, maybe You will want to prisolit or pepper.
step-7
Spread the rice over the slices of kohlrabi. At desire it is possible even slightly to throw oil.
